Detoxification - New Windsor

People who are physically dependent to drugs or alcohol and want help will 1st go through detoxification before getting other treatment services in drug rehab. Detoxification is simply the process of the drug being eliminated from one's system, which is generally uncomfortable and may hold risks if not executed in a setting which can offer appropriate support and medical intervention as required. Detox services are provided at either a professional drug or alcohol detox facility or a drug treatment facility which can properly oversee and supply medical supervision for men and women who are just coming off of drugs. Detoxification services generally include insuring the client is as relaxed as possible while detoxing and going through drug or alcohol withdrawal, providing proper nutrition and making certain the person is getting proper rest, and supplying supplements and medicine as needed to make the detoxification process as easy and safe as possible. The individual in detoxification will sometimes be encouraged to take part in some sort of physical activity such as walking, yoga, etc. At a drug detox facility or drug rehabilitation facility which can supply detox services, the person will have detoxification staff at their disposal around the clock to guarantee that any complications are resolved as rapidly and safely as possible.
